Jun 15, 2020 · Joanne Smith is Executive Vice President and Chief People Officer for Delta Air Lines. She leads the company’s global talent management, total rewards, HR service delivery, and diversity, equity, and inclusion functions in support of the 100,000 employees who make up Delta’s unique people-first culture.
